KXLO: Tester to Farm Bill committee: Don’t undermine Montana ranchers and producers
Senator Jon Tester is leading a bipartisan effort to protect Montana’s livestock and poultry producers from the unfair business practices of some of the nation’s biggest packing corporations.
Tester wants Senate leaders working on a compromise-version of the Farm Bill to reject a provision backed by the House of Representatives that would block USDA from enforcing laws designed to stop unfair, anti-competitive business practices, such as last-minute contract cancellations and price-fixing.
Tester, along with Republican Senator and fellow farmer Chuck Grassley (R-Iowa), want to make sure that USDA can continue to enforce provisions from the 2008 Farm Bill that protect small agricultural producers.
